In simple terms, base load means more or less continuous operations.
As opposed to "two-shifting" or "peak lopping" where plant is started and stopped one or more times per day to meet changes in demand.
 
Any generating set will have a maximum continious rating. At this load the unit operates at maximum efficieny. There is certainly a scope of generating more power but it will be at the cost of sacrificing the inbuilt margins which is called as peak load operation.

Normal pattern of any load (i.e. load curve) is highly fluctuating type. There is lot of difference in hightest peak, lowest peak and average load.

If any generating station is meant to supply the lowest peak of the load curve, then that is called the base load operation of generating station.

The Base Load (Power Generation). The minimum load over a given period of time. Reference IEEE Std 858-1987 "Standard Definitions in Power Operations Terminology"

jbartos is right, load profile versus time plot will help to comment on what is base load generation and pls also also clarifies is your plant operate in parallel with utility / grid, if yes then only question of base load comes. If you will be operating in isolation with Grid, there is no question of base load because in that case what will be the load on your generator, that will be the base load.
 
with reference to generating station base load is minimum continuous generation of the station. for which certain generator / set of generators is always running. during peak hours other machines are started to take care of increased load demand.
